LACTOSE
Description
A noninvasive test used to diagnose gastrointestinal disorders. It is used to evaluate lactose malabsorption due to acquired or congenital lactase deficiency. The test is based on the quantitative determination of hydrogen in the breath compared to baseline.
The test is performed by collecting breath in a bag after ingesting a solution containing a substrate dissolved in a glass of water.
The breath collection kit is used to collect breath samples from patients suspected of having gastrointestinal tract disorders related to the absorption and/or digestion of certain nutrients.
How to use
Patient preparation
In the 15 days preceding the examination, the patient must avoid taking antibiotics.
In the 7 days preceding the test, the patient should not take any therapy containing lactic acid bacteria, prokinetics, or laxatives. The use of antibiotics or excessive use of laxatives can reduce the intestinal flora, compromising the test result.
The day before the test, the patient must avoid: complex carbohydrates and fiber (fruit, vegetables, bread, pasta, and legumes), alcohol, and carbonated drinks.
On the day of the examination the patient must:
- have fasted for at least 8-10 hours;
- avoid drinking water or, if necessary, drink only half a glass of still water;
- absolutely avoid smoking;
- avoid excessive physical exertion.
Brushing your teeth is permitted. Before the exam, rinsing your mouth with a chlorhexidine-based mouthwash is recommended.
During the examination the patient must:
- avoid sleeping;
- avoid drinking (even water).
It is recommended that you follow your doctor's instructions regarding test preparation.
Running the test
Collect baseline breath (time 0) before administering lactose (not supplied in the kit).
The patient should blow into the bag until it is full of air. Using a syringe, draw 20 cc of air from the bag. Immediately close the syringe with the cap, without forcing it too tightly. Mark the syringe with the #1 sticker on the back of the plunger.
Empty the bag completely.
Administer the patient the dose of lactose (not supplied in the kit) dissolved in 200 ml of natural water (25 g for adults and 12.5 g for children). Over the next 4 hours, collect exhaled breath every 30 minutes (an additional 8 measurements), marking each syringe with the number of the "puff" taken.
Fill out the analysis request form with the patient's details, the name of the requesting doctor, and the email address to receive the report.
Close the kit containing the syringes filled with exhaled breath with the seal and send it to the reporting laboratory.
Results
The test is considered positive if the H2 value in the exhaled breath exceeds 20 ppm compared to the baseline value.
The reporting laboratory will indicate the reference values and the interpretation of the test result.
Warnings
Certain rules must be followed to successfully complete the test. Failure to prepare thoroughly will result in the exam being ineligible.
It is advisable to postpone the test in the presence of significant diarrhea, acute intestinal pathologies (gastroenteritis), and in the case of recent diagnostic procedures that the patient has undergone (colonoscopy).
Care should be taken to protect the test kit components from contamination. Do not use if there is evidence of microbial contamination or deterioration.
Conservation
Store at room temperature (2-30°C).
Do not use the tests beyond the expiration date indicated on the package.
Shelf life when packaging is intact: 36 months.
Format
The kit contains:
- 1 bag for collecting breath;
- 9 syringes for collecting breath;
- 9 leak-proof syringe caps;
- 9 adhesive numbers for syringe identification;
- 1 guarantee seal to close the kit;
- 1 instructions for use.
